DR Congo President Clears Path for Third Term? Referendum Law Sparks Debate
Some residents of Kinshasa are backing a controversial new referendum law in the Democratic Republic of Congo. The opposition has denounced the ruling, saying it gives President Félix Tshisekedi the green light to seek a third term in office. Supporters argue the law is necessary for political stability and development, though details of the proposed changes remain unclear. The debate highlights deep divisions in the country ahead of any potential vote.
